Definition

To check information using two or more sources to make sure it is correct.

Usage & Nuances

'Crosscheck' is formal and often used in academic, business, and news contexts. Common phrases include 'crosscheck the data' and 'crosscheck with another source.' Not to be confused with 'double-check,' which means checking twice, not using different sources.
